Description
Constructed of gilded brass, the obverse featuring a radiant starburst bearing a central raised insignia of the Hungarian National Defence Association (Magyar Országos Véderő Egyesület/MOVE), the reverse with a clip and claws emanating from a functional roller, unmarked, measuring 65 mm (w) x 42 mm (h), an exceptionally rare buckle in extremely fine condition.
Footnote: The Magyar Országos Véderő Egyesület (Hungarian National Defense Association/MOVE) was founded in 1919 in the wake of the collapse of Austria-Hungary and the fall of the Hungarian Soviet Republic, during a period of political upheaval and painful territorial loss. Established by nationalist military officers and conservative figures, including Gyula Gömbös, MOVE functioned as a nationalist organization dedicated to preventing the spread of communism to Hungary, promoting Christian values, and advocating for the revision of the Treaty of Trianon. In the early 1920s it operated as a grassroots membership association with strong ties to veterans’ groups, paramilitary networks, and segments of the emerging Horthy regime, helping to mobilize support for counterrevolutionary and nationalist causes. While not a political party itself, it influenced public life through agitation, propaganda, social and youth activities, and the cultivation of a disciplined, patriotic ethos among its members. Its prominence declined as Hungary’s political system consolidated under Regent Miklós Horthy and as other nationalist movements and parties assumed greater roles; by the late 1930s its independent significance had largely faded, and it eventually ceased to function as a distinct organization amid wartime conditions and disappeared at the end of the Second World War.
